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Стоимость товара с фиксированной скидкой


Recommended Posts

Здравствуйте.

В товаре есть цена и фиксированная скидка. На один товар 100 грн, на другой товар 120, на третий товар скидка 150 грн. В товарах есть опции с ценой. При выборе опции общая цена изменяется (основная цена плюс цена опции).  

Необходимо реализовать, чтобы фиксированная скидка всегда оставалась одинаковой. Т.е. всегда вычиталась из общей цены. Цена товара без опций 500-100=400. Добавили опцию, стоимостью 23 грн.  -  на странице товара и в заказе должно быть 523-100=423. Добавили две опции к товару. 546-100=446.  Добавили три опции к товару. 569-100=469.

Т.е. фиксированная скидка 100 грн всегда  отнимается от Общей цены товара с опциями (суммы). 

Пример.   При выборе 1, 2, 4 кресел скидка остается одинаковой 1741. Эта скидка вычитается из суммы товара плюс стоимость всех опций. 

https://prnt.sc/UTlEXJrmpqFc  Два кресла в опциях

https://prnt.sc/DZNbVOjtG4YM   Четыре кресла

Для каждого товара эта скидка разная. Товаров много! Цена и скидка может меняться.

Загружаем товары, автоматически обновляем цену и скидки модулем парсинга Симплпарс.

Фиксированную скидку можем записать в какое-то стандартное поле карточки товара (скидка, акция... или другое стандартное поле  https://prnt.sc/4LlxP1yF6k8x  ) или в поле какой-либо таблицы базы данных при необходимости. 

 

Как вариант. Доработать Опенкарт. Чтобы цена для расчета общей стоимости товара с опциями бралась не из поля Цена карточки товара, а с учетом индивидуальной скидки на каждый товар (Цена минус Скидка плюс стоимость опций...). 

 

Version 3.0.3.7  шаблон Aridius (Deluxe)

Надіслати
Поділитися на інших сайтах


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ку
×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.